Infection
Infection is the invasion of an organism's body tissues by disease-causing agents, their multiplication, and the reaction of host tissues to the infectious agents and the toxins they produce.

Vaccine
A vaccine is a biological preparation that provides active acquired immunity to a particular disease.

Virus
A virus is a small infectious agent that replicates only inside the living cells of other organisms.
